  • The Benefits: Beyond Water Savings

    Artificial grass isn’t just about water conservation—it also provides multiple long-term advantages that make it a smart investment for landscapers and property owners alike.

    1. Low Maintenance, High Reward
    Traditional lawns require constant upkeep—mowing, watering, fertilizing, and pest control. Artificial grass, on the other hand, is virtually maintenance-free. Once installed, it doesn’t need watering, mowing, or harmful chemicals, reducing both time and money spent on upkeep. For busy property owners, this is an attractive feature that allows them to enjoy their landscape without the hassle of ongoing care.

    2. Cost Savings
    While the initial cost of installing artificial grass may be higher than planting a traditional lawn, the long-term savings quickly outweigh the upfront investment. With no need for irrigation, fertilizer, or lawn care services, artificial turf becomes a cost-efficient solution. Additionally, because it is designed to withstand heavy use and weather conditions, it lasts for years without needing replacement.

    3. Family and Pet-Friendly
    Artificial grass creates safe, functional outdoor spaces for families with children and pets. Unlike natural grass, it’s free from chemicals, mud, and allergens, making it a cleaner option for outdoor play. Plus, artificial turf is durable enough to handle high foot traffic and activities like running, jumping, and even digging from pets—without showing signs of wear and tear.

  • Here are some innovative ways to incorporate artificial grass into water-saving landscape designs:

    1. Mixed Hardscaping and Turf Areas
    One of the most effective ways to design a water-efficient landscape is by combining artificial turf with hardscaping elements like pavers, stone pathways, and gravel. This reduces the overall footprint of vegetation while creating visually appealing outdoor spaces. Artificial grass can soften the look of large hardscaped areas, offering greenery without the need for irrigation.

    2. Drought-Tolerant Plant Pairings
    Incorporate artificial grass alongside native and drought-tolerant plants, such as succulents and ornamental grasses. This combination creates a lush and layered landscape that feels natural but uses minimal water. Grouping plants strategically around artificial turf can create a dynamic contrast and enhance the overall design.

    3. Synthetic Grass for Outdoor Living Areas
    Many homeowners are transforming their backyards into outdoor living areas where they can relax and entertain. By using artificial grass, designers can create vibrant green spaces for seating areas, outdoor kitchens, and fire pits. This combination of greenery and functionality offers the perfect balance between comfort and sustainability.

    4. Artificial Grass Accents in Vertical Gardens
    For properties with limited horizontal space, vertical gardens are a trendy and eco-friendly solution. Incorporating artificial turf into vertical green walls can add depth and texture without increasing water use. Artificial grass panels can be interspersed with other elements like ivy, succulents, or colorful flowering plants to create striking visual effects.

    5. Play Areas and Pet Spaces
    Artificial grass is an ideal solution for play zones and pet-friendly areas. It offers a soft, safe surface for children and pets to enjoy while being easy to clean and maintain. Creating dedicated play areas with artificial grass in family-friendly yards adds both functionality and visual appeal, without the wear and tear that natural grass endures.

  • Why TriFlow Backing™ Makes VistaPet™ the Ultimate Pet-Friendly Turf Solution

    When it comes to artificial grass, especially for pet owners, having a turf that’s durable, easy to maintain, and drains effectively is crucial. That’s why Turf Distributors developed TriFlow Backing™, a cutting-edge three-layer system designed specifically to enhance the performance of artificial grass. Here, we’ll explore how this advanced technology revolutionizes pet turf by offering unparalleled durability, drainage, and strength, making it the perfect choice for our new VistaPet™ turf.

    What is TriFlow Backing™? 

    TriFlow Backing™ is a proprietary technology designed to improve the durability and performance of artificial grass. The innovative three-layer system includes:

    • A Strong Woven Polypropylene Base: This foundational layer ensures that the turf is resilient and stable, even under heavy foot traffic or energetic pets.
    • A Flexible Non-Woven Polyamide and Polyethylene Terephthalate Middle Layer: This layer adds flexibility and structural support while maintaining excellent drainage properties, ensuring your artificial lawn stays dry.
    • A Clear, Thin but Robust Polyolefin Coating: This top layer binds the artificial grass fibers securely in place, reinforcing the backing’s strength while allowing water to flow through easily.

    Together, these layers create a high-performance system that stands up to wear and tear while keeping your turf looking great and functioning optimally.

    The Growing Demand for Artificial Grass

    In recent years, the artificial grass market has seen steady growth, with projections showing this trend will continue well into 2025. The global artificial turf market was valued at $2.9 billion in 2021 and is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.8% from 2022 to 2028 . The North American market, in particular, has seen increased demand, driven by water shortages, the desire for eco-friendly landscaping, and the ongoing pursuit of low-maintenance outdoor spaces.

    Artificial grass is no longer just for sports fields or decorative purposes—it has become a core element in modern landscape design. For irrigation and hardscape professionals, offering artificial turf as part of their service is becoming essential to meet customer demands. Homeowners and commercial property owners alike are seeking long-lasting, realistic turf that requires minimal water and maintenance.

  • Making Playgrounds Accessible with ASTM F1951-Compliant Artificial Grass

    If you’re adding artificial grass to a playground, making sure it meets ASTM F1951 standards is key to keeping the space accessible for everyone, including individuals using wheelchairs and other mobility devices. While artificial grass can be designed to meet these standards, the whole installation—including the base, infill, and transitions—needs to be done right to ensure compliance. 

    What is ASTM F1951 and Why Does It Matter? 

    ASTM F1951 measures how easy it is for wheelchairs to move across a surface. Just having ASTM F1951-certified artificial grass isn’t enough—the entire system, from the base to the edges, plays a role in making sure the surface is safe and accessible.

    Key Factors for Compliance

    1. Stability and Firmness

    1.  
    • The surface needs to be solid and supportive, so mobility devices don’t sink or get stuck. 
    • A well-compacted base and evenly applied infill help maintain stability over time.

    2. Pile Height and Infill Choices

    1.  
    • Shorter pile heights (typically 1.25 inches or less) make it easier to move across the surface. 
    • Infills, such as sand or coated rubber granules, should be evenly spread to prevent uneven areas. 
    • If infill is too loose or deep, it can make movement difficult.
